U.S. patent number D795,255 [Application Number D/583,692] was granted by the patent office on 2017-08-22 for biometric payment gateway device. This patent grant is currently assigned to HYPR CORP.. The grantee listed for this patent is HYPR CORP.. Invention is credited to George Avetisov, Roman Kadinsky, Bojan Simic.
